The story is in the archives and I don't have access. Brett Prettyman wrote it as part of the Trib's hunting section last year. I actually know Brett and he told me that the Forest Service didn't really know what to say when he called and asked them if they had any policies on them. When they got back to him they told him they would treat them like tree stands. Portable tree stands are not illegal and neither are trail cams, but if forest service employees come across them and no one is there to watch or claim them they will take them down and take them to the nearest office. The reason is that people can't leave them in the woods or make them permenant like nailing them to a tree. I'll send Brett an e-mail and see if he can send me a copy.
